This paper proposes an improved version of current electronic fraud detection system by using logging data sets for Video-on-Demand system. Our approach is focused on applying Artificial Immune System based fraud detection algorithm for logging data information and accounting and billing purposes. Our hybrid approach combines algorithms from innate and adaptive parts of immune system, inspired by the Self non-self theory and the Danger theory. Our research proved the possibility of combining these to perform E-fraud detection. The experimental results demonstrated that hybrid approach has higher detection rate, lower false alarm when compared with the performances achieved by traditional classification algorithms such as Decision Tree, Support Vector Machines, and Radial Basis Function Neural Networks. Our approach also outperforms AIS approaches that use Dendritic Cell Algorithm, Conserved Self Pattern Recognition Algorithm, and Clonal Selection Algorithm individually.
